Understanding the Connection Between Fatigue and Vertigo

Vertigo is a disorienting sensation where you feel like either you or your surroundings are spinning or moving when they aren’t. It’s more than just dizziness—it’s a specific type of imbalance often linked to inner ear issues or neurological problems. But what role does being tired play in triggering these unsettling episodes?

Fatigue, especially extreme tiredness, can affect the body’s equilibrium mechanisms. When you’re exhausted, your brain and nervous system don’t function at peak efficiency. This can interfere with how your body processes sensory information from your eyes, inner ears, and muscles—all crucial for maintaining balance.

In simple terms, being tired can make your balance system more vulnerable. It lowers your threshold for vertigo triggers and amplifies symptoms if you already have an underlying condition like vestibular neuritis or benign paroxysmal positional vertigo (BPPV). So yes, fatigue isn’t just about feeling sleepy; it can actively provoke vertigo.

How Fatigue Impacts the Body’s Balance Systems

Your sense of balance depends on three main inputs:

    • Visual system: Your eyes provide spatial orientation.
    • Vestibular system: Located in the inner ear, it detects head movements and position.
    • Proprioceptive system: Sensory nerves in muscles and joints inform the brain about body position.

When you’re tired, these systems don’t communicate as effectively. Fatigue slows down neural processing speed and reduces coordination between sensory inputs. This breakdown can cause conflicting signals reaching the brain, leading to vertigo.

Moreover, fatigue often correlates with dehydration and low blood sugar—both known to worsen dizziness and imbalance. The brain needs adequate hydration and glucose to function properly; without them, neurological functions falter.

The Role of Sleep Deprivation in Triggering Vertigo

Sleep deprivation is a common cause of fatigue that directly influences vertigo risk. Lack of sleep affects cognitive functions such as attention, concentration, and reaction time—all vital for maintaining balance.

Studies show that people who suffer from chronic sleep deprivation report higher instances of dizziness and vertigo episodes. Sleep loss disrupts the autonomic nervous system responsible for regulating blood pressure and heart rate during postural changes. This disruption can lead to orthostatic hypotension—a sudden drop in blood pressure when standing up—causing lightheadedness or vertigo.

Therefore, insufficient rest doesn’t just make you feel tired; it creates physiological conditions ripe for vertigo attacks.

Common Causes of Vertigo Exacerbated by Fatigue

Being tired doesn’t cause all types of vertigo directly but acts as a catalyst that worsens certain conditions:

Vertigo Condition Description How Fatigue Worsens It
Benign Paroxysmal Positional Vertigo (BPPV) Brief episodes triggered by head movement due to displaced ear crystals. Tiredness reduces neural control over balance reflexes, increasing episode frequency.
Meniere’s Disease Inner ear disorder causing vertigo attacks with hearing loss and tinnitus. Fatigue stresses the body’s fluid regulation in the ear, triggering attacks.
Vestibular Neuritis Inflammation of vestibular nerve causing sudden severe vertigo. Lack of rest impairs immune recovery prolonging symptoms.

Fatigue acts like fuel on a fire for these conditions. It weakens compensatory mechanisms that usually help keep symptoms at bay.

The Role of Dehydration and Nutrition in Fatigue-Induced Vertigo

Often overlooked is how dehydration worsens both fatigue and vertigo symptoms simultaneously. Water makes up about 60% of our body weight and is essential for nerve conduction and muscle function.

When dehydrated:

    • The volume of blood circulating drops causing reduced oxygen delivery to the brain.
    • This leads to lightheadedness or dizziness especially upon standing up quickly.
    • Lack of electrolytes disrupts nerve signaling involved in balance control.

Similarly, poor nutrition—like skipping meals—lowers blood sugar levels critical for brain energy metabolism. Hypoglycemia triggers shakiness, sweating, confusion, and sometimes vertigo episodes.

Treatment Approaches When Fatigue Triggers Vertigo Episodes

Managing vertigo triggered by being tired requires addressing both symptoms simultaneously:

    • Adequate Rest: Prioritize consistent sleep routines aiming for seven to nine hours nightly.
    • Mild Physical Activity: Gentle exercises like walking improve circulation reducing dizziness risk without causing overexertion.
    • Nutritional Support: Maintain balanced meals rich in electrolytes (potassium, sodium) along with ample water intake throughout the day.
    • Maneuvers for BPPV: Specific head movements like Epley maneuver reposition displaced crystals reducing spinning sensations.
    • Meditation & Relaxation Techniques: Lower mental fatigue by calming nervous system activity which indirectly improves balance control.

In cases where vertigo persists despite lifestyle changes or worsens significantly after periods of exhaustion, consulting an ENT specialist or neurologist is crucial for targeted treatments such as vestibular rehabilitation therapy or medications.

The Role of Medication in Managing Vertigo Related to Fatigue

Certain medications may help alleviate acute symptoms but should be used cautiously:

    • Dimenhydrinate (Dramamine): Useful for short-term relief of nausea associated with vertigo episodes caused by tiredness-induced imbalance.
    • Benzodiazepines (e.g., Diazepam): Sometimes prescribed but carry risks of sedation which could worsen fatigue if overused.
    • Steroids: Used occasionally in inflammatory causes like vestibular neuritis but require medical supervision due to side effects impacting energy levels.

Medication alone won’t solve underlying causes related to poor rest but can provide symptomatic relief during flare-ups.

The Impact of Chronic Fatigue Syndromes on Vertigo Frequency

Chronic fatigue syndrome (CFS) is characterized by prolonged debilitating exhaustion not relieved by rest. Individuals with CFS often report frequent dizziness or vertiginous sensations even without identifiable vestibular pathology.

Research suggests this may stem from persistent autonomic dysfunction seen in CFS patients affecting cardiovascular regulation during positional changes. The overlap between chronic fatigue states and recurrent vertigo highlights why managing energy reserves carefully is vital in preventing dizzy spells.
